--- Comment #12 from Clément Péron <peron.clem at gmail dot com> ---
The Bugs is still present in GCC 4.6.4 and 4.8.2.
.strX.X try to optimize string constants but when you disable it the var are
moved into .rodata instead of .rodata.__function when the -fdata-sections is
enabled.
